I've been floating around at sea, contemplating the profession and have returned to life as a librarian. I split my time now between a specialized science library and a college art library in part-time positions.

What I've realize is that my premise that selling your collections -- and housing sell-able collections is more important than ever.

Just this morning I was at a Wendy's listening to people. One needed a class and connection to a Genealogy collection, another a connect to business resources and another group simply needed to know about the Foundation Center.

I submit to you -- the voices of those who need what we have are active, loud and constant.

As librarians, we need to pay attention to people from the reference desk to the check out line. The check out line in the local supermarket.

What people want from us is hardly a mystery. What programs would work -- not a question that merits a survey.

Listen your way to your next programming calendar.
